I'm Indian so I think I may know why.
Standards.
In India there are over a billion people which means to get the job that you want, you have to put in a little extra work. For most of us, we have only one chance to succeed. Competitive students in High School there wake up at 5, study, go to school, come home at 3, go to another school for further study and usually are around home at 8 or 9. Then of course many have jobs and all have home work. Well thats what it was like when I lived there a few years ago.
Also there's TREMENDOUS family pressure. Another thing, were not all super smart. In the US, you seem to see only smart Indians because mostly only the most educated and talented get here. Have you ever been to a 7-11?

Another case of perception. Yes, of course they are smart, just like everyone else.
Thing is, there are millions of them in India that are not doctors, CEO's etc.... and in fact are far more poor than the average American.
BUT, the successful ones (the "elite" Indians) can affort to leave the basicly third world country (it may have changed, it's been about 20 years since I've been there), often come here. So THOSE are the Indians you see. They are likely also the ones you pay attension to.
I take nothing away from the beautiful people of India, they are smart, and some not-so-smart, the same as us.
